概括
这项研究引入了一种新型的四甲基维奥基因,可以防止水性电色装置 (ECD) 中的二分化. 新的viologen提供了卓越的稳定性和性能,使先进的基于水凝的ECD应用成为可能.

背景情况:
- 维奥基因对电色器件 (ECD) 至关重要,但由于水溶液中的二元化,其电化学可逆性较差.
- 这种限制限制了它们在水性电色器件 (ECD) 中的应用.
研究的目的:
- 设计和合成一种新型的四甲基原衍生物,以克服水性介质中的二元化问题.
- 评估这种新型生物素在水性电色装置 (ECD) 中的性能.
- 探索这种生物原体在开发先进的基于水凝的ECD方面的潜力.
主要方法:
- 合成2,2',6,6'-四甲基-4,4'-二二胺酸 ([MVH][Br]) 通过固态阻碍来防止二元化.
- 制造和测试水性电色器件 (ECDs) 使用合成的viologen.
- 调查viologen的稳定性,光学调制和对UV聚合物的耐受性.
- 使用水电离子混合凝和in situ紫外线聚合物的双色色电磁探测器的演示.
主要成果:
- 甲基替代有效地防止了二元化,从而在水溶液中产生出色的电化学可逆性.
- 制造的水性ECD显示出卓越的颜色变化,光学调制和循环稳定性,在5000个循环后保留了95.48%的光学调制.
- 紫外线聚合物对紫外线聚合物的强度被证明是强大的,这使得使用可治疗紫外线的离子混合凝能够创建双色色电子电磁体.
结论:
- 开发的四甲基维奥基因 ([MVH][Br]) 显著提高了水性电色装置 (ECD) 的性能和稳定性.
- 这种紫外线聚合物对紫外线聚合物的耐药性为制造机械坚固,基于水凝的ECD开辟了新的途径.
- 该研究推进了在水性ECD和水凝材料中的viologens的应用,用于未来的电子设备开发.

Indicators
Certain organic substances change color in dilute solution when the hydronium ion concentration reaches a particular value. For example, phenolphthalein is a colorless substance in any aqueous solution with a hydronium ion concentration greater than 5.0 × 10−9 M (pH < 8.3). In more basic solutions where the hydronium ion concentration is less than 5.0 × 10−9 M (pH > 8.3), it is red or pink. pH
The potential of hydrogen (pH) is a measure of the acidity or basicity of a water-based solution determined by the concentration of hydronium ions (H3O+). In one liter of pure water at neutral pH, there are 1×10−7 moles of hydronium ions. However, the extensive range of hydronium ion concentrations present in water-based solutions makes measuring pH in moles cumbersome. Potentiometry: Types of Electrodes
Reference electrodes serve as a stable reference point for potentiometric measurements, while indicator and working electrodes react to variations in the composition of a solution.
The Standard Hydrogen Electrode (SHE) is a widely used reference electrode that maintains zero potential across all temperatures. However, its need for a continuous hydrogen gas supply renders it impractical for everyday use.

Redox Titration: Other Oxidizing and Reducing Agents
Besides iodine, other oxidizing or reducing agents can serve as titrants in redox titrations. Common oxidizing titrants include KMnO4, cerium(IV), and K2Cr2O7. The choice of oxidizing titrants depends on factors like stability, cost, analyte strength, and reaction rate between the analyte and titrant. Effects of EDTA on End-Point Detection Methods
Different methods, such as visual observance of metal-ion indicators, spectroscopic techniques, and potentiometric methods, can determine the endpoint of an EDTA titration.
In the visual method, metal-ion indicators (metallochromic dyes), which have distinct colors in their free and complex forms, are added to the mixture to signal the titration's end point.
